MySQL管理秘籍:优化技巧与运维高效指南
|
在日常的MySQL运维工作中,性能优化是保障系统稳定运行的关键环节。作为大模型安全工程师,我们不仅要关注数据库的安全性,还需要深入理解其内部机制,以便在面对高并发、大数据量时做出合理调整。 索引设计是提升查询效率的核心手段之一。合理使用索引可以显著减少磁盘I/O和内存消耗,但过多或不当的索引反而会增加写入开销。建议根据实际查询模式进行分析,避免冗余索引的存在。 连接数限制和超时设置同样不容忽视。通过调整max_connections参数,可以防止资源耗尽导致的系统崩溃。同时,合理配置wait_timeout和interactive_timeout,有助于释放空闲连接,提高整体资源利用率。 定期执行维护任务如OPTIMIZE TABLE和ANALYZE TABLE,能够帮助数据库保持良好的性能状态。这些操作虽然会占用一定资源,但在低峰期执行可有效减少对业务的影响。
AI生成的图像,仅供参考 备份策略是保障数据安全的基础。采用增量备份结合全量备份的方式,既能保证恢复速度,又能降低存储成本。同时,确保备份文件的加密和异地存储,是防范数据泄露的重要措施。监控工具的使用能帮助我们及时发现潜在问题。利用Prometheus、Grafana等工具,可以实时掌握数据库的运行状态,提前预警可能的性能瓶颈。 持续学习和实践是提升运维能力的关键。随着技术不断发展,新的优化方法和工具层出不穷,只有不断更新知识体系,才能应对日益复杂的数据库环境。 (编辑:草根网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330473号